This '08 P71's cruise buttons all test good at the PCM connector, and the SCDS is closed; but cruise still won't engage, including above 40mph. The owner's manual doesn't mention anything disabling cruise other than the OFF button, or driving under 30mph. Will these ABS &/or IC faults cause it to disable? They all re-appear instantly after clearing. Other than no cruise, the car drives perfectly, but I haven't tried to engage ABS. The brake & ABS warning lights are on solid, but occasionally both go out & that fault disappears (without clearing) briefly. The PID for the RESUME button doesn't change state when the button is pressed, and the SCDS PID says NOT SUPPORTED. I don't know that the cruise ever worked on this car, but the wiring to the PCM, and the SCDS are present.
